    As we await the start of the 2024 season for the Green Bay Packers, how does Jordan Love’s first season as a starter compare to Aaron Rodgers’?

    It was a big decision for the Green Bay Packers to end the Aaron Rodgers era before the 2023 season. With Rodgers easily being a future Hall of Famer and still playing good football, the Packers decided that it was time to reset as they did many years before when Rodgers was given the reins of the franchise after years of success with Brett Favre.

    In Rodgers’ first season with the Packers, he had an excellent year under center. He totaled 4.038 passing yards, 28 touchdown passes, and 13 interceptions in 16 games. Despite the strong season from Rodgers, Green Bay finished with a 6-10 record and missed the playoffs.

    What has to be exciting for the Packers is looking back at what Rodgers did in his first season and comparing that to Jordan Love in his first season as the starter. For Love in 2024, he totaled 4,159 passing yards, 30 passing touchdowns, and 11 interceptions.

    As a team in Love’s first year, the Packers finished with a 9-8 record and reached the playoffs. In the playoffs, the Packers were able to upset the Dallas Cowboys on the road as more than a touchdown underdog, and then they went into San Francisco and nearly beat the 49ers.

    While the game is a bit different from 2008 in Rodgers’ first season as a starter to Love’s in 2024, the franchise should be very pleased to see that Love was able to have more touchdown passes and fewer interceptions than Rodgers. Also, winning a playoff game in his first season as a starting quarterback is extremely impressive.

    We all know the success that Aaron Rodgers had after 2008 with the Packers and now all eyes will be on Jordan Love to see if he can continue his upward trajectory.
